#603f8c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#603f8c is composed of 37.6% red, 24.7%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.4% cyan, 55%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 265.7 degrees, a saturation of 37.9% and a lightness of 39.8%. #603f8c color hex could be obtained by blending #c07eff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#603f8c color description : Dark moderate violet.
#603f8c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#603f8c has RGB values of R:96, G:63,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 6307724.
